By Application

Cement Grinding Aids:

Cement grinding aids are crucial in the construction industry, and Ethanol Diisopropanolamine plays an instrumental role in enhancing the efficiency of cement production. EDIPA helps to reduce the energy consumption during the grinding process, allowing for smoother operations and improved productivity. By minimizing the agglomeration of particles, EDIPA enhances the flowability and workability of the cement, resulting in higher-quality products. With the construction sector expected to grow significantly in the coming years, the application of EDIPA in cement grinding aids is anticipated to expand correspondingly, driven by rising construction activities and increasing infrastructure projects globally.

By Region

The regional analysis of the Ethanol Diisopropanolamine (EDIPA) market reveals significant variances in consumption and demand. North America holds a substantial share of the market, driven by robust growth in the construction and personal care sectors, projected to grow at a CAGR of around 5.8% due to increasing infrastructure investments and a preference for eco-friendly chemicals. The region's well-established manufacturing base and regulatory framework also support the adoption of EDIPA across various applications. Europe follows closely, with its stringent regulations on chemical usage pushing manufacturers towards sustainable alternatives like EDIPA. The European market is expected to maintain steady growth, fueled by rising demand in the agriculture and oil industries.

Asia Pacific is emerging as a prominent region in the EDIPA market, reflecting rapid industrialization and increasing agricultural practices. With countries such as China and India focusing on enhancing their agricultural yield, the demand for EDIPA as a herbicide ingredient is anticipated to surge, contributing to a robust CAGR of approximately 6.0% during the forecast period. In Latin America and the Middle East & Africa, growth is expected to be more moderate, influenced by sector-specific demands such as construction in the Gulf countries and agricultural developments in Brazil. Overall, the regional dynamics suggest a favorable outlook for the global Ethanol Diisopropanolamine market, with North America and Asia Pacific leading growth trajectories.
